Ive been thinking about Elizabeth Whitmore, the remarkable woman who lived to 117. Researchers believe her extraordinary lifespan might hold secrets to ageing gracefully, showing how old age and illness dont always go hand in hand. Elizabeth was the worlds oldest person when she passed away last year in Bath, Englandbut her biological age, according to her genome, might have been far younger.
Theres something captivating about supercentenarians like herthose who reach at least 110. What makes them different? Before her death in August 2024, Elizabeth agreed to help British scientists uncover the mystery. At 116, they took samples of her blood, saliva, urine, and stool, studying her genetics and microbiome against larger groups of elderly individuals.
What they found was fascinating. Despite her advanced years, Elizabeth had remarkably low inflammation, a “rejuvenated” gut, and a surprisingly youthful epigenomechanges in gene expression without altering DNA. The researchers called her “one exceptional individual.” She also had rare genetic variants that seemed to shield her from common ailmentsheart disease, diabetes, and neurodegenerative conditions like Alzheimers and Parkinsons.
Their study, published in *Cell Reports Medicine*, suggests fresh insights into human ageing, pointing to potential biomarkers for health and strategies to extend life. Genetics clearly played a role, but her lifestyle mattered too. Elizabeth ate three yoghurts daily, which might have helped her gut health and weight. She followed a balanced diet, slept well, stayed active, and maintained strong mental health.
Socially, she thrivedreading, playing the piano, gardeningliving a well-rounded life. The researchers noted that her case challenges the assumption that ageing and disease are inseparable.
